laurent.thillaye
Spot the occasional politician
St Stephens Tavern offers a glimpse into London high society. Located a short walk from Westminster Abbey and Big Ben, the pub offers full-course fine dining and a really well-stocked bar. The antique furniture is beautiful and there's a huge chandelier right in the entrance that becomes you to come in and explore. It's a good place for a drink if you happen to be in the area and want to soak up some old-fashioned charm or spot the occasional politician.



+4